Eighty percent of Iowa residents recently surveyed indicated their support for legalising cannabis for medicinal purposes, a large jump from a 2013 poll that showed 58% support it. The Des Moines Register/Mediacom Iowa Poll reports 88 percent of young adults and 67 percent of senior citizens support medical marijuana. With...

Ireland's Health Products Regulatory Authority’s report on medicinal cannabis has been published and the nation's Health Minister has announced a compassionate access programme will proceed. In what the Minister Simon Harris described as a "milestone" in medicinal marijuana policy development for Ireland, the Cannabis for Medical Use – A Scientific...
The U.S. legal cannabis industry will no doubt be watching the progress of the Respect State Marijuana Laws Act very closely. The Act, introduced last week, seeks to protect parties from some provisions of the Controlled Substances Act in circumstances where they are acting in compliance with state marijuana laws. The...

New Zealand's Associate Health Minister has announced all decision-making for the prescribing of cannabis-based products in the country will be delegated to the Ministry of Health. Up until now, the buck has stopped with Associate Health Minister Peter Dunne. He states he has approved every application that landed on his...
